What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970, Section (5)(a)(1):  The employer did not furnish employment and a place of employment which were free from recognized hazards that were causing or likely to cause death or serious physical harm to employees due to fire, burn, and deflagration hazards associated with combustible dust:  A.)  Rupe Industries, LLC dba Johnson Industries Pallets, 6774 Orangeville Road, Sharpsville, PA  16150, main assembly building, on or about April 7, 2021 and times prior thereto:  Employees were potentially exposed to fire, burn, and deflagration hazards from cyclones, and their associated duct work, that was not equipped with devices and systems to prevent the propagation of deflagration and associated flame fronts from the cyclone through the associated duct work and back into the building and to the dust collection bin.  The cyclones processed combustible wood dust.  B.)  Rupe Industries, LLC dba Johnson Industries Pallets, 6774 Orangeville Road, Sharpsville, PA  16150, main assembly building, on or about April 7, 2021 and times prior thereto:  Employees were potentially exposed to fire and burn hazards from cyclones, and their associated duct work, that was not equipped with devices and systems to detect and suppress fires, sparks and embers within the cyclones and their ductwork.  The cyclones processed combustible wood dust.  C.)  Rupe Industries, LLC dba Johnson Industries Pallets, 6774 Orangeville Road, Sharpsville, PA  16150, main assembly building/dust collection bin area, on or about April 7, 2021 and times prior thereto:  Employees were potentially exposed to fire and burn hazards associated the operation of a gasoline-powered front-end loader in the dust collection bin.  The front-end loader was used to scoop and move the combustible wood dust.  Dust clouds were present in the air.

29 CFR 1910.307(c):  Equipment, wiring methods, and installations of equipment in hazardous (classified) locations were not intrinsically safe, approved for the hazardous (classified) location, or safe for the hazardous (classified) location:  A.)  Rupe Industries, LLC dba Johnson Industries Pallets, 6774 Orangeville Road, Sharpsville, PA  16150, main assembly building/dust collection bin area, on or about April 7, 2021 and times prior thereto:  Electrical devices powering equipment including, but not limited to, pneumatic conveyers (blowers) were located in an environment with combustible dust.  The electrical devices was not classified for a Class II environment.  These electrical devices included, but were not limited to, a 480-volt electrical disconnect.   B.)  Rupe Industries, LLC dba Johnson Industries Pallets, 6774 Orangeville Road, Sharpsville, PA  16150, warehouse area, on or about April 7, 2021 and times prior thereto:  Accumulations of combustible dust were on the surfaces of electrical equipment including, but not limited to, flexible cords/cord cap and electrical receptacle boxes/cover plates.  The electrical devices were not classified for a Class II environment.

29 CFR  1910.22(a)(1):  The employer did not ensure that all places of employment, passageways, storerooms, service rooms, and walking-working surfaces are kept in a clean, orderly, and sanitary condition:  A.)  Rupe Industries, LLC dba Johnson Industries Pallets, 6774 Orangeville Road, Sharpsville, PA  16150, main assembly building/dust collection bin area, on or about April 7, 2021 and times prior thereto:  Employees were potentially exposed to fire and explosion hazards associated with combustible dust that had accumulated on surfaces including, but not limited to, walls, beams, shelves, and ledges.  The dust accumulation ranged from 1/8-inch to in excess of 12-inches.   B.)  Rupe Industries, LLC dba Johnson Industries Pallets, 6774 Orangeville Road, Sharpsville, PA  16150, warehouse area, on or about April 7, 2021 and times prior thereto:  Employees were potentially exposed to fire and explosion hazards associated with combustible dust that had accumulated on surfaces including, but not limited to, electrical receptacles/cover plates and flexible cords/cord caps.  The dust accumulation were in excess of 1/8-inch.
